Description

Flagyl Suspension contains Metronidazole, an antibiotic and antiprotozoal medication. It is commonly prescribed to treat a wide range of bacterial and parasitic infections, especially those of the gastrointestinal tract, liver, mouth, skin, and reproductive system. The suspension form makes it particularly suitable for children and patients who have difficulty swallowing tablets.


Uses of Flagyl Suspension

  • Treatment of amoebiasis (intestinal and extra-intestinal)

  • Management of giardiasis (Giardia infection)

  • Treatment of trichomoniasis (urogenital infection)

  • Bacterial infections of the stomach, intestines, liver (including liver abscess)

  • Dental infections, gum diseases, and post-dental surgery infections

  • Infections of the respiratory tract, skin, or bones caused by anaerobic bacteria


How it Works

  • Metronidazole (200mg/5ml): Works by entering bacterial and protozoal cells and disrupting their DNA synthesis, which leads to the destruction of infection-causing organisms.

  • It is especially effective against anaerobic bacteria and protozoa.


Dosage & Administration

  • Dose depends on the age, weight, and type of infection.

  • Usually prescribed for 5–10 days, as directed by the doctor.

  • Shake the bottle well before use.

  • Measure the dose accurately using the provided measuring cup or spoon.

  • Complete the full course even if symptoms improve early.


Possible Side Effects

Common:

  • Nausea, vomiting

  • Loss of appetite

  • Metallic taste in the mouth

  • Abdominal discomfort, diarrhea

Less Common but Serious:

  • Allergic reactions (rash, itching, swelling)

  • Seizures, dizziness, confusion

  • Dark-colored urine (harmless but can be alarming)

  • Liver enzyme changes


Warnings & Precautions

  • Avoid Alcohol: Strictly avoid alcohol during treatment and at least 48 hours after the last dose, as it can cause severe reactions (nausea, vomiting, headache, rapid heartbeat).

  • Liver Problems: Dose adjustment may be needed in liver impairment.

  • Neurological Conditions: Patients with seizures or nerve disorders should use with caution.

  • Pregnancy & Breastfeeding: Use only if prescribed by the doctor.
